Core Insights - The article discusses the differentiation of large model companies in Silicon Valley, highlighting OpenRouter as a key player in model routing, which has seen significant growth in token usage [2][3][6]. Group 1: OpenRouter Overview - OpenRouter was established in early 2023, providing a unified API Key for users to access various models, including mainstream and open-source models [6]. - The platform's token usage surged from 405 billion tokens at the beginning of the year to 4.9 trillion tokens by September, marking an increase of over 12 times [2][6]. - OpenRouter addresses three major pain points in API calls: lack of a unified market and interface, API instability, and balancing cost with performance [7][9]. Group 2: Model Usage Insights - OpenRouter's model usage reports have sparked widespread discussion in the developer and investor communities, becoming essential reading [3][10]. - The platform provides insights into user data across different models, helping users understand model popularity and performance [10]. Group 3: Founder Insights - Alex Atallah, the founder of OpenRouter, believes that the large model market is not a winner-takes-all scenario, emphasizing the need for developers to control model routing based on their requests [3][18]. - Atallah draws parallels between OpenRouter and his previous venture, OpenSea, highlighting the importance of integrating disparate resources into a cohesive platform [19][20]. Group 4: OpenRouter Functionality - OpenRouter functions as a model aggregator and marketplace, allowing users to manage over 470 models through a single interface [31]. - The platform employs intelligent load balancing to route requests to the most suitable providers, enhancing reliability and performance [37]. - OpenRouter aims to empower developers by providing a unified view of model access, allowing them to choose the best models based on their specific needs [34][35]. Group 5: Future Directions - OpenRouter is exploring the potential of personalized models based on user prompts while ensuring user data remains private unless opted in for recording [52][55]. - The platform aims to become the best reasoning layer for agents, providing developers with the tools to create intelligent agents without being locked into specific suppliers [58][60].
